Background
In some electric power construction environments, workers are required to ascend, such as construction specification training of cement poles of agricultural distribution lines. Because the fixed anti-falling device can not be installed on the cement pole of the agricultural distribution line, the operator with qualification and professional skill must ascend the height to operate when the anti-falling device is hung, before training, the operator climbs the pole to hang the anti-falling device, after training, the operator climbs the pole to remove the anti-falling device, but the operator does not have anti-falling protection when hanging and removing the anti-falling device, and therefore, certain potential safety hazards exist when the anti-falling device is hung and removed.

Detailed Description

Example (b): as shown in fig. 1 to 4, a device for remote disassembly and assembly of a falling protector, comprising an operating rod 100, a traction rope 200 and a clamp 300, wherein the clamp is provided with a rope pulley 400, the traction rope is wound on the rope pulley, a rotating shaft of the rope pulley is transversely arranged, so that the traction rope can hang on the ground, a fixed pulley and rope winding matched structure is formed, the clamp is provided with an installation part, the operating rod is connected with the installation part, the clamp is provided with a hanging part 301 and an automatic locking part, the clamp is hung on a cross arm 500 through the hanging part and then clamped on the cross arm by the automatic locking part, the traction rope is provided with a lock head 501, the clamp is provided with a lock catch 502 matched with the lock head, the head of the operating rod is provided with an operating head for operating the lock head, and the lock catch is controlled to be buckled into and separated from the lock catch through the operating head.
The installation sleeve 302 is arranged on the clamp, the operating rod is inserted into the installation sleeve, the operating rod and the installation sleeve are in an insertion mode, the operation is simple, the operation is in place in one step, and the operating rod and the clamp can be conveniently installed for multiple times in the use process of the falling protector. The self-locking portion is an L-shaped turning plate 305, the turning plate comprises a first baffle 306 and a second baffle 307, the junction of the first baffle and the second baffle is hinged to the opening of the hanging portion, and when the clamp is hung on the cross arm, the cross arm pushes the first baffle upwards to enable the turning plate to rotate, so that the second baffle is located below the cross arm. The hanging part is provided with a downward opening, the length of the first baffle is designed to be larger than that of the second baffle, so that the gravity center of the turning plate is positioned below the first baffle, the clamp is hung on the cross arm in front of the cross arm, the first baffle is transversely blocked at the opening of the hanging part, the second baffle is vertical, the cross arm pushes the first baffle upwards in the process that the clamp is hung downwards into the cross arm, the cross arm enters the hanging part, the first baffle is vertical, the second baffle is transversely blocked at the opening of the hanging part, and at the moment, the cross arm is firmly limited in the hanging part; when the clamp is to be taken down, the clamp is lifted upwards through the operating rod, the cross arm pushes the second baffle downwards to turn the turnover plate, so that the opening of the hanging part can be made, and the clamp is taken down from the cross arm.
The operating head (not shown in the figure) is detachably arranged at the head of the operating rod, the dismounting work of the safety hook can be completed only by one operating rod, and when needed, the operating head is only required to be arranged at the head of the operating rod, for example, in a threaded screwing mode. Of course, a plurality of different operation rods can be prepared, some operation rods are provided with operation heads which are specially used for operating the lock head, and some operation rods are not provided with operation heads which are used for operating the clamp.

In addition, the clamp can be left on the cross arm according to the situation, and when the safety hook is used next time, the safety hook can be pulled to the cross arm to be hung well only by pulling the traction rope, so that the labor intensity of workers can be reduced.
